This excursion will offer a scenic tour in the best exposed Lower-Middle Permian to Lower-Middle Triassic (Buntsandstein) terrestrial sequence of Sardinia, which can be considered one of the key-sections for the whole western peri-Tethys. Different types of fluvial settings, and their richness of sedimentary structures, can be magnificently observed. Paleosols geochemistry and APS minerals content in the Permian and/or Buntsandstein will be a theme of discussion, as well as the new data on absolute dating on the Nurra and Provencal coeval successions. The unique and recent found vertebrate and tetrapod/invertebrate tracks localities, both in Permian and Triassic, will be shown. Main topics of the excursion will be:
- Regional unconformities and tectonics aspects;
- Permian and Triassic fluvial facies and architectures;
- Mineralogical and geochemical aspects;
- Vertebrate sites and taphonomy;
- Vertebrate and invertebrate ichnological sites.
